Cielo Digital Infrastructure has embarked on a monumental venture, securing a $2.1 billion investment for a data center campus in Cherokee County, South Carolina. This strategic move will feature four expansive facilities, each spanning 400,000 square feet, and an electrical substation, potentially generating 300 megawatts upon completion. Expected to be operational by 2028, this initiative underscores Cielo’s commitment to strategically connecting with energy hubs vital to this industry. Nationwide Expansion and Strategic Focus

Cielo is not resting solely on its laurels in South Carolina but is aggressively expanding its capacity across the United States. With significant projects in states such as Florida, Tennessee, Illinois, Colorado, Missouri, Texas, Minnesota, and Iowa, the company is in pursuit of gigawatts of total capacity. Noteworthy projects, like a 300MW facility in Haines City, Florida, and a sprawling 750MW development over a 500-acre site in Hudson, Colorado, epitomize Cielo’s robust expansion strategy.
